Preparation checklist for a smoother removal van booking

Preparing well can save time, reduce stress, and help your move stay on track. Even if you are using a full van service, a little organisation makes a noticeable difference.

  • Pack and label boxes clearly by room
  • Disassemble items where practical, such as bed frames or table legs
  • Empty drawers and secure loose parts
  • Protect fragile items with suitable wrapping
  • Set aside important documents and valuables to move personally
  • Reserve parking where possible or note any restrictions
  • Tell the mover about stairs, lifts, or difficult access
  • Confirm which items are going and which are staying behind

You do not need to pack everything perfectly, but a bit of structure helps the loading process go more quickly. It is especially useful if you are moving from a flat, where access and timing may matter more. If you have items such as mirrors, glass tables, artwork, or delicate electronics, mark them clearly so they can be handled with extra care.

Preparation is one of the easiest ways to reduce moving day stress. It gives the removal team a clearer job to do and helps you stay focused on the next step of the move.

Pricing factors for removal van hire in Mill Hill

Customers often want a clear idea of what affects the cost of a removal van service. While exact prices depend on the details of the job, several factors usually influence the quote. Understanding these helps you compare services fairly and choose the right option for your move.

Common pricing factors include:

  1. Volume of items – More furniture and boxes usually require a larger van or more time.
  2. Distance travelled – Local Mill Hill moves may be priced differently from longer journeys.
  3. Access conditions – Stairs, narrow entrances, parking distance, and other challenges can affect the job.
  4. Time required – The length of loading, transport, and unloading all matters.
  5. Additional handling – Dismantling, reassembly, or careful transport of bulky items may influence the quote.
  6. Schedule – Peak moving periods or specific timed slots can affect availability.

A sensible approach is to request a detailed quote based on your actual moving requirements rather than guessing. If you are unsure whether you need a small van, a medium-sized vehicle, or a larger removal van, describe the job as fully as possible. A reliable local service should be able to suggest a practical solution without pushing you toward unnecessary capacity.

Frequently asked questions

How far in advance should I book a removal van in Mill Hill?

It is best to book as early as you can, especially if you are moving during a busy period, at month-end, or on a weekend. Earlier booking gives you more choice over timing and helps ensure the right van size is available.

Can I use a removal van for just one or two large items?

Yes. Many customers only need help with a sofa, bed, wardrobe, washing machine, or similar bulky item. A van service is often more practical than arranging a larger move for a small job.

Do I need to pack everything before the van arrives?

It is helpful to have boxes packed and labelled before the team arrives, but you do not need to make the process perfect. The main priority is to have the move-ready items clearly separated from anything that is staying behind.

Can you help with stairs and awkward access?

Yes, but it is important to mention stairs, lift access, and parking issues before the move. That allows the service to be planned properly and the right level of support to be arranged.

Is a removal van suitable for office moves as well as home moves?

Absolutely. Many local businesses use removal vans for office equipment, stock, furniture, and deliveries. The service can be adapted to suit either residential or commercial needs.

What should I tell you when asking for a quote?

Provide as much detail as possible: pickup and delivery areas, property type, number of rooms, large items, access issues, and preferred dates. This helps create a more accurate and practical quote.
